GAME PROJECT - personal projects



I learnt alot from creating the vehicles for this game, however, I felt I could do more to learn about using Maya or 3D in a way that's suitable for games. I had kept the models simple before to ensure the resolution would not be to high to fit in the game. However with these exercises shown here I learnt new techniques to create low resolution props and models that can be animated within a game and its game play.

One of the first exercises I tried was to create some foliage for a game. The best method to create  and irregular shape, like this ivy leaf, was maya's create polygon tool. I added the details to create a high resolution leaf. But for just one leaf, this created alot of polygons to the model.

Used normal maps to create the leafs texture from the high res model. Add 32 bit in photoshop to use alpha channel. Only use alpha channels when using opacity maps as the empty alpha channel takes a lot of space within a game. Also, only alpha opacity maps use 32 bits to compensate for the alpha channel.

GAME PROJECT - BIKE

The smallest of the vehicles to be built next is the bicycle! This I thought would be the simplest but when I attempted it I was very wrong.

I started by gathering images and plans for bikes. The most complex part would be to create the gears so images that included the gears was important. Its important that the wheels of the bike can be animated but not necessary to animate the gears.

One method I tried to build the frame of the bike, was to use extrusions along a curve. However I found the simplest method was to just use the extrusion method I had used before with the car and the tank, starting with a block and extruding the shape until it resembles the bike frame. This was effective but creates a blocky, square frame. Extruding along a curve, using NURBS circles, may have produce a smoother, rounder frame.

The handles and seat were created separately, as were the wheels. This was also to make the texture map editing simpler, when it came down to arranging the UV layout.

Once I lay out the UV's for each section of the bike I used Photoshop to create the textures that would then be placed over the UV layout. I was able to do this using the layers to see the UV outline and another layer for colour. Of course when placing the texture on the model in Maya, the outline of the UV texture shouldn't be included. Otherwise black outlines would show across the models texture. This is quite an interesting effect but not one I'm after with these models.

The bike had the most UV layouts and separate textures as this made it simpler when unfolding the UV layouts in the UV editor. Unlike say the tank or car which, though larger models were much simpler to unfold.

Games design - Building a car - MAYA

For this games design module we've teamed up with programmers who are designing a game that teaches concepts of physics to students between the ages of 14-19. The game engine they will be using is the free software, UNITY!

My team have designed their game that demonstrates the laws of physics by using different size vehicles to roll down a hill and land on a target. The idea is simple which makes it suitable for students in the age range    to learn these concepts.

My task is to create these vehicles. Using Maya, I will be creating a bicycle, car and a tank. The wheels should be able to move independently as the vehicle moves forward and back so to roll down the hill and gain momentum from its own weight (its weight would be programmed in UNITY).

To start with I began by building the simplest of these vehicles, the car. For this I chose a simple car design (fiat PANDA). I used simple extruding methods to create the shape and details for the car in Maya.

The next step was to work out how I could rotate the wheels of the car.

I used the tutorial above and advice from tutors, who suggested using locators in Maya to create the movement of the wheels. This works nicely in Maya, but found when importing the object into UNITY, the locators were there but had no effect. This wasn't a problem however, for the programmers, as they said the texture itself could be animated to spin as the car moved, as opposed to the wheels themselves. This I was told would be a more efficient method and could be done in UNITY.

The next step then for me was to texture the car. The model is fairly simple so the texture would be responsible for extra details. I had quite a few problems at first when trying to apply my textures. I found this was due to trying to add too many textures to one model e.g. the car body was one colour, but the windows were to be more clear and transparent. But the problems started when I tried to directly apply this using Maya's own textures. I discovered this cant be done in Maya, which is why texture mapping is vital for this.

With the texture maps, I would be able to create a texture map, which I can apply all the textures to. I used help from tutorials online and games design books to help work out how to move and sew textures together to create a flat, opened out layout of the car.

I could then import the map into Photoshop CS5 and build them there.
